In the formula d=r×t, if d equals 60, which of the following is equivalent to r?

To isolate r in the equation d = r × t, we need to manipulate the formula. The given formula expresses the relationship between distance (d), rate (r), and time (t). Since we know that d equals 60, we can substitute that value into the equation, resulting in 60 = r × t.

To find r, we need to solve for it by dividing both sides of the equation by t. This gives us r = 60/t.

This means that the value of the rate r is equivalent to 60 divided by the time t. Thus, in the context of the choices given, option B, which states (60/t), accurately represents the calculation we performed to isolate r from the original equation.

Other choices do not correctly represent the isolation of r. For example, multiplying t in option A or dividing t by 60 in option C do not maintain the relationship defined by the original equation. Therefore, option B is the only choice that correctly captures the equivalent expression for r when d equals 60 in the formula d = r × t.
